Chaim Bloom is entering his first offseason as baseball operations president and has emphasized adding to the scouting department. Joe Douglas, after eight years with the Pirates, was hired as director of pro acquisition and will work under assistant GM and director of scouting Randy Flores. Jacob Buffa, with nearly seven years in Houston and recent experience as senior director of player development and performance science, was hired as senior director of international scouting and will report to assistant GM, international scouting Moises Rodriguez. The Cardinals missed the postseason three straight years and have not won a playoff series since 2019. The farm system improved from 20th to 12th in MLB.com's midseason rankings, with recent draft picks Lefty and JJ Wetherholt emerging as top prospects.
